How is a supervisory relationship with a physician documented?

0

A. Each New Jersey PA should submit a copy of a “Verification of Supervision/Employment” form to the Physician Assistant Advisory Committee within 10 days of establishing a new supervisory relationship. If a PA works in multiple clinical jobs, a form should be submitted for each supervising physician. A copy of this form may be downloaded by CLICKING HERE.
